Schorr" Date: Thu, 29 Jun 2006 20:20:52 +0000 Subject: [ospfd] Implement new ospf router subcommand "log-adjacency-changes [detail]" 2006-06-28 Erik Muller * ospfd.h: Define 2 new struct ospf config flags: OSPF_LOG_ADJACENCY_CHANGES and OSPF_LOG_ADJACENCY_DETAIL * ospf_nsm.c (nsm_change_state): Log adjacency changes if requested. * ospf_vty.c (ospf_log_adjacency_changes): New command function to implement ospf subcommand "log-adjacency-changes [detail]". (no_ospf_log_adjacency_changes) Turn off log-adjacency-changes. (show_ip_ospf) Show whether adjacency changes are logged. (ospf_config_write) Add "log-adjacency-changes [detail]" to config. (ospf_vty_init) Add ospf_log_adjacency_changes and no_ospf_log_adjacency_changes. * ospfd.texi: Document new ospf router subcommand "log-adjacency-changes [detail]". --- doc/ospfd.texi | 7 +++++++ 1 file changed, 7 insertions(+) (limited to 'doc/ospfd.texi') diff --git a/doc/ospfd.texi b/doc/ospfd.texi index ff0d78b9..c859782e 100644 --- a/doc/ospfd.texi +++ b/doc/ospfd.texi @@ -90,6 +90,13 @@ but still both preferred to external paths.
